Product Detailed Description:
The DSNU Series (ISO 6432 Mini Round Cylinder) is the industry benchmark for reliability and versatility. Crafted with a precision-drawn 304 stainless steel barrel, it offers exceptional resistance to wear and harsh environments. The cylinder’s design follows strict international standards, ensuring 1:1 dimensional compatibility for seamless replacement of existing DSNU setups.
Equipped with high-performance NBR seals and a chrome-plated steel piston rod, the DSNU series delivers smooth linear motion with minimal friction. It is available with both elastic cushioning (P) and adjustable pneumatic cushioning (PPV/PPS) to handle varying load impacts. Whether used in high-frequency packaging or delicate lab equipment, the DSNU series provides a robust, space-saving solution for modern automated systems.

Application:
1. Electronic Component Assembly :
The DSNU is widely used in SMT lines and PCB testing equipment. Its small bore sizes (8mm-16mm) allow for high-precision component ejection and placement. The stainless steel body ensures zero particulate contamination, which is critical in cleanroom environments where microchips and sensitive sensors are manufactured.
2. Food & Beverage Packaging:
Due to its corrosion-resistant stainless steel construction, the DSNU is the premier choice for "wash-down" areas in food processing. It drives diverting arms on conveyor belts and controls small-scale filling valves. It can withstand humidity and mild cleaning agents without rusting, ensuring food safety and reducing downtime.
3. Pharmaceutical & Lab Automation:
In diagnostic instruments and pill-packaging machines, the DSNU provides the gentle yet repeatable motion required for test tube handling and blister pack ejection. Its compact round body allows it to be tucked inside portable medical devices, providing reliable actuation in a very small footprint.
Installation and Usage:
1. Mounting Options: The DSNU is a "threaded-end" cylinder. You can mount it directly through a panel using the nose nut, or use mounting accessories like Foot Brackets (MS1) or Flange Plates (MF8). Ensure the mounting point is rigid to prevent vibration.
2. Piping and Filtration: Before connecting the air tubes, flush the lines with compressed air to remove debris. Always use a 40μm filter to protect the internal seals.
3. Speed Adjustment: To ensure the longevity of the seals and end caps, use one-way flow control valves (elbow speed controllers) to regulate the extension and retraction speed.
4. Cushioning Adjustment (PPV Models): For cylinders with adjustable cushioning, use a flat-head screwdriver to turn the cushioning screw. Adjust until the piston reaches the end-of-stroke without a loud "clack" but without stopping prematurely.
5. Rod Alignment: The piston rod must move in a perfectly straight line with the load. Any side-loading (lateral force) will cause the rod bushing to wear unevenly and lead to air leaks. Use a self-aligning rod coupler if misalignment is unavoidable.
FAQ
Q1.Is this DSNU cylinder a direct replacement for the Festo brand?
A1.Yes. Our DSNU series follows the ISO 6432 standard. Dimensions, mounting threads, and port sizes are 1:1 identical to the Festo DSNU series, making it a drop-in replacement.
Q2.What is the benefit of the stainless steel barrel?
A2. Unlike aluminum cylinders, the stainless steel barrel is highly resistant to scratches and corrosion. It provides a smoother internal surface for the piston seals, resulting in a longer lifespan and better performance in humid environments.
Q3.Does it come with the mounting nut?
A3.Yes, each DSNU cylinder includes the high-strength hex nut for the nose/neck thread as standard.
Q4.What is "PPS" cushioning?
A4. PPS stands for Pneumatic Positioning System (Self-adjusting cushioning). It automatically adapts to changes in load and speed, eliminating the need for manual adjustment screws.
Q5.Can I use this for high-speed applications?
A5. Absolutely. The lightweight piston and low-friction seals allow the DSNU to handle speeds up to 1500 mm/s, depending on the bore and air pressure.
Q6.Are the magnetic sensors included?
A6. The cylinder has a built-in magnet, but the sensors (auto-switches) are sold separately. It is compatible with standard C-slot or band-mount sensors.
Q7. What is the maximum stroke you can provide?
A7.While standard strokes are up to 200mm, we can manufacture custom strokes up to 500mm for bore sizes 20mm and 25mm.
Q8. Can this cylinder be repaired if the seals wear out?
A8. The DSNU series features a "rolled-in" end cap design for maximum air-tightness and compactness. This means it is generally a non-repairable unit, but its long service life typically exceeds millions of cycles before needing replacement.
Q9.How long is the service life?
A9.Depends on load, speed and air quality; typically millions of cycles with proper filtration (5 μm filter recommended) and lubrication.
